Description

The CP200 is a dedicated Corrosive Substance Storage Cabinet tested for chemical resistance by the CSIRO. Isolate small quantities of Class 8 Corrosives (up to 20 litres) in this high density Polyethylene Safety Cabinet, which is completely metal-free.

Features of Storemasta's Polyethylene Corrosive Cabinet include a 100% high density polyethylene construction, liquid-tight spill containment sump, fully adjustable shelving (optional extra shelves) and a self-closing door that can be locked. The Corrosive Safety Cabinet comes complete with mandatory warning placards.

Features

  • High capacity liquid tight spill containment sump to contain spills
  • Self closing, close fitting doors. Doors do not open inward and can be opened from within the cabinet
  • Corrosive resistant latch with no metallic components
  • Strong fully adjustable shelving perforated for free air movement, 100mm adjustable increments
  • Fully welded polyethylene construction
  • Optional vent openings and flash arrestors [for mechanical ventilation systems]
  • Manufactured with UV-stabilized High Density Polyethylene (HDPE)  for high durability and performance
  • Distinct safety signs and directions that comply with AS 1216 and AS 1319
  • Designed and manufactured in full conformance to AS 3780:2023 - The storage and handling of corrosive substances

Dimensions (mm)

External H 600 W 470 D 470
Internal H 450 W 425 D 425

 

Other Specifications

Weight 30.0 kg
Shelf Levels 2
Storage Levels 2
Shelf Thickness (mm) 15
No. of Shelf Lugs 10
